dc.description.abstractLEO satellites cause frequent handoff by high mobility, narrow beam coverage, and dynamic topology. Frequent handoff causes excessive routing path switching and increased signal overhead. The existing terrestrial routing methods try to minimize the routing path switching and reduce overhead by different routing table updating processes that update neighboring routers and all area routers during handoff. However, the existing routing methods advance routing with the fixed router. In this paper, we review recent research on reducing overhead during handoff in routing algorithms that are applied to static topology generated by dividing dynamic topology.-
